I don't care much about messages in movies (don't like 'em; don't dislike 'em). The way I see it is that no single piece of entertainment can change the way you think. It can affect you emotionally for a moment, and it may even stick with you for sometime after watching the movie, but changing the way you think is a gradual process (much more gradual as you get older). This movie won't change a racist's beliefs nor will it turn someone into a racist, IMO.

The reason I don't think think this movie is over-rated is because I wasn't exposed to the hype when it was released. I was starting out in the military in '98, and movie/tv watching was at the bottom of my list of things to do. That said, I think this is a fantastic movie. I love it. It's in my top ten all-time favorites. Norton is an outstanding actor. He gets lost in his roles much in the same way Johnny Depp does.
